Why These Are the Top Honda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Vega

** The Honda repair market for Vega, Texas residents is centralized in the nearby city of Amarillo. Vega itself, with a population of around 900, lacks specialized automotive service centers, creating a natural reliance on the larger market 30-40 minutes away. The market in Amarillo is moderately competitive with a mix of dealerships and independent shops. The highest-rated independents compete effectively with the Honda dealership on price and personalized service, often developing niche expertise in specific systems like transmissions or hybrid batteries. Typical pricing is competitive for the region, with general maintenance starting at a lower cost than dealerships, while complex diagnostics and transmission work command premium but fair market rates. For specialized services like performance tuning for Type R models, owners may need to consider shops in larger metropolitan areas like Lubbock or Dallas.

What are the most common Honda repair issues for drivers in the Vega, Texas area?

In Vega, common issues include air conditioning system strain from the hot, dry Panhandle climate and premature wear on suspension components like struts and bushings due to rough county roads. Honda models, especially older Civics and Accords, may also experience transmission concerns, which a local specialist can diagnose accurately.

How can I find a reputable and trustworthy Honda repair shop near Vega?

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who have specific Honda experience, and check for online reviews from other local customers. In a smaller community like Vega, asking for personal recommendations at local businesses or from neighbors is also an excellent way to find a reliable mechanic familiar with Hondas.

When should I seek local service for my Honda's check engine light in Vega?

You should seek service promptly if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ire, or if it's steady and accompanied by noticeable performance issues like rough idling or loss of power. For Vega residents, a local shop with a modern scan tool can quickly pull the specific diagnostic codes common to Hondas to prevent further damage.

Are Honda repair costs in Vega typically higher than for other brands?

Honda repair costs in Vega are generally reasonable due to the brand's reliability and good parts availability. However, costs can vary between independent shops and dealerships; sourcing parts locally in Vega may sometimes lead to slight delays compared to larger cities, which can affect timing but not necessarily the final price.

What local driving conditions in Vega should influence my Honda's maintenance schedule?

The dusty, windy conditions and temperature extremes of the Texas Panhandle mean you should adhere strictly to oil change intervals and inspect air filters more frequently. Also, the gravel and uneven rural roads around Vega necessitate more frequent checks of tire pressure, alignment, and the undercarriage for wear and damage.
